<description>&#60;p&#62;I have sensitive combination skin too, and I’m kind of a product junkie, so I’ve tried a bunch of stuff. Lots were fine and I don’t have any complaints about them – but I also didn’t really see or feel results, so “meh” rating from me. Might work better for other people, as they are usually well-rated products. &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;I use the Dr. Hauschka system, which I love and have been using for years. My morning routine is: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Dr. H cleansing milk&#60;br /&#62;
Dr. H clarifying toner&#60;br /&#62;
Dr. H daytime eye cream&#60;br /&#62;
I don’t need a lot of moisturizer, and what I use depends on the season. SK-II essence and then either a few drops of Dr. H normalizing day oil (great for oily skin), or some light moisturizer. &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Nighttime routine is: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Remove makeup with a baby wipe (cheap &#38;amp; on hand, FTW)&#60;br /&#62;
Wash with Cetaphil&#60;br /&#62;
Dr. H toner&#60;br /&#62;
Shiseido night eye cream (I really like this)&#60;br /&#62;
SK-II Facial Treatment essence (I’ve only been using this for a few weeks, so far I like it, but I don’t know yet if I love it)&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Other nighttime/wrinkle/anti-aging products I’ve used and thought were fine, but didn’t love: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Ava Anderson&#60;br /&#62;
Elemis&#60;br /&#62;
Skinceuticals A.G.E Interrupter &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Supplemental masks, etc. that I do love: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Dr. H Rejuvenating/Revitalizing mask&#60;br /&#62;
GlamGlow Supermud clearing treatment (if you have sensitive skin only leave this on for a couple of minutes at most – it hurts if left on more than that, but I do see results)&#60;br /&#62;
Honey – regular honey, I use a local raw honey

<description>&#60;p&#62;I use a ton of things, I don't do all the steps every single night though.  I have sensitive, normal skin.  If I use too many hydrating products, I get those white bumps on my face so I have to watch what I am using.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;In the morning, in my shower, I use a scrub, currently the Walmart knockoff of the Nuetrogena grapefruit scrub, but not every day.  Then I use a Skinsueticals sunscreen, that has no moisturizer.  I use a CeraVe day lotion.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;At night, I wash my face with a gentle soap, I can't recall what brand I am using right now, it's from the drugstore, so nothing fancy.  I am using the Missha Essence that everyone raves about and I have noticed a change in the texture of my skin.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Then, I do my creams.  I have a ton of them that I alternate.  Sometimes I use the Olay Regenerist Overnight mask, sometimes I use a Korean Snail Mucin cream. I am finishing up an eye cream that I bought while living abroad, I don't love it so I will look for something else.
